It's not every day that you get to launch a product in a more than 2,000-year-old language spoken by more than 70 million people. That's why we're excited to tell you that Google News is now available in Tamil. Tamil is one of the most widely-spoken languages in India, which is no mean feat considering that there are 22 official languages here.

In simple words it is one type of restriction for newer websites by not allowing them to get higher rankings in google search engine. A new website with quality backlinks and even with good content does not receive higher rankings for important keywords and phrases for certain period of time. The sanbox effect is also one type of test for newer websites, as google wants the best websites or quality content oriented websites or established websites to be listed first to provide quality results to users. One of the important factors in ranking well on search engines such as Google is ensuring that you have a number of links pointing from other websites to your website. Website links can be a confusing thing, there are many terms used to describe them including one way links, reciprocal links, backlinks, inbound links but to explain what I'm talking about here - lets say you own ACME Shoe Sales, and you are on another website say www.great-aussie-footwear.com and you see a link that says "Visit ACME Shoe Sales" and you click on it - and it takes you to the ACME Shoe Sales, then this helps the ranking of ACME Footwear. There are several ways you can increase Google page rank - several techniques can be used to get that highly coveted #1 spot in Google search. But first, what is page rank? The Google page rank tells you how important a website is. It tells you how many sites are linked to another website. Page rank is denoted by the number 0 to 10 and the higher the number, the more important the site is. Read the rest of this entry »
